Concrete Foundation Pouring in Fredericksburg, VA
Concrete foundation pouring services involve the process of creating a stable and durable base for residential or commercial structures. This service typically covers a range of projects, including new home construction, additions, basement foundations, and garage slabs. Homeowners often seek this service to ensure their property has a solid foundation that can support the weight of the building and prevent issues like settling or cracking over time. Before requesting foundation pouring, property owners usually want to understand the scope of work, the type of concrete used, and any necessary preparations or permits required for the project.
Proper foundation pouring requires careful planning and execution to ensure long-term stability. Property owners should consider factors such as soil conditions, drainage, and local building codes when discussing their project. It’s also important to clarify the timeline, the quality of materials, and the steps involved in the process. Understanding these aspects can help homeowners make informed decisions and ensure the foundation is built to meet the structural needs of their property.

Concrete Foundation Pouring Questions
What types of projects require concrete foundation pouring? Foundations are typically needed for new buildings, additions, or repairs to stabilize and support structures on a property.
How does soil condition affect foundation pouring? Soil stability and composition influence the type of foundation and preparation needed to ensure proper support and prevent settling.
What preparations are necessary before pouring a concrete foundation? Site clearing, leveling, and proper excavation are essential steps to ensure a stable base for the foundation.
What are common foundation types used in residential projects? Common types include slab-on-grade, crawl space, and basement foundations, each suited to different property needs and conditions.
